Mini Golf Courses in Illinois
Illinois features diverse mini golf experiences from Chicago's urban courses to suburban family entertainment centers.
Illinois benefits from having both a world-class metropolitan area and hundreds of miles of small-town heartland, each contributing its own style to the state's mini golf scene. Chicagoland's suburban belt from Schaumburg to Naperville to Orland Park is packed with family entertainment centers where mini golf is a centerpiece attraction drawing weekend crowds year after year. These suburban venues invest heavily in their courses, with themed 18-hole and 36-hole layouts that feature waterfalls, caves, and bridges, all designed to compete for the attention of families with plenty of options.
Downtown Chicago itself has embraced indoor and rooftop mini golf as an urban entertainment format that fits the city's social scene. Several venues in the Loop, River North, and Wicker Park neighborhoods offer adult-oriented experiences that combine creative course designs with food and drinks, turning mini golf into a social outing rather than just a family activity. These city courses tend to be smaller but more inventive, using limited space in ways that feel fresh and engaging to a sophisticated audience.
Central and southern Illinois maintain a more traditional approach to the game. Springfield, Peoria, and Champaign have courses that have been community fixtures for years, often family-owned and operated with a personal touch that chain entertainment centers cannot replicate. These venues draw steady local crowds and serve as affordable date-night and birthday-party destinations that families return to season after season.
The Illinois mini golf season runs roughly from April through October for outdoor courses, with the state's unpredictable spring weather sometimes pushing opening day into May. Indoor facilities in the Chicago suburbs keep the game going year-round, which is important in a state where winter temperatures can keep families indoors for months at a time. The result is a state where mini golf thrives in both its classic outdoor form and its newer indoor incarnations, offering something for every preference and season.
